The Global Heavy Haulage Market: Scale, Scope & Strategic Importance

The transportation of oversized industrial machinery and steel coils represents one of the most technically demanding and economically significant segments within the global logistics industry. As manufacturing output, infrastructure investment, and international trade volumes continue to rise, the demand for specialized big trucks capable of handling extreme payloads and non-standard cargo dimensions has never been greater.

Steel coils — the foundational raw material for automotive, construction, appliance, and shipbuilding industries — can weigh between 5 and 30 tonnes per unit, demanding trucks engineered with reinforced chassis, precision load-securing systems, and advanced suspension technology. Similarly, oversized industrial machinery such as turbines, transformers, mining equipment, and prefabricated plant modules require specialized flatbed and lowboy trailers matched with purpose-built prime movers capable of sustained high-torque output under extreme load conditions.

Why Big Trucks Are Engineered Differently for Industrial & Steel Coil Transport

🏗️

Structural Integrity Under Extreme Load Conditions

Transporting steel coils and oversized industrial machinery imposes unique stress profiles on a truck's frame, axles, and suspension. Unlike general freight, these loads are concentrated, asymmetric, and often exceed standard weight limits. Purpose-built heavy trucks integrate high-tensile steel ladder frames, multi-leaf spring or air suspension systems, and reinforced cross-members to distribute load forces evenly — preventing frame fatigue, axle overload, and cargo shift during transit.

🔩

High-Torque Powertrain

Oversized cargo demands engines capable of sustained torque output at low RPM — essential for climbing gradients and maintaining momentum with payloads exceeding 40 tonnes. Advanced turbocharged diesel engines with outputs of 400–600+ HP are standard in this segment.

🛡️

Reinforced Chassis Architecture

High-tensile steel frames with optimized cross-section geometry provide the backbone for safe heavy haulage. Finite element analysis (FEA)-optimized designs ensure maximum rigidity with minimal weight penalty, directly improving payload efficiency.

🎯

Precision Load Securing Systems

Steel coil transport requires specialized coil cradles, V-shaped load beds, and integrated tie-down anchor points. Proper load securing prevents coil roll, reduces cargo damage, and ensures compliance with international road transport safety regulations.

🌡️

Advanced Thermal Management

Extended hauls under heavy load generate significant drivetrain heat. Modern heavy trucks feature oversized cooling systems, transmission oil coolers, and exhaust brake systems to maintain optimal operating temperatures across diverse climatic conditions.

📡

Smart Telematics Integration

Real-time GPS tracking, load monitoring sensors, and predictive maintenance alerts allow fleet operators to optimize routes, monitor cargo integrity, and minimize unplanned downtime — critical for time-sensitive industrial supply chains.

Fuel Efficiency Technology

Aerodynamic cab designs, intelligent transmission systems, and engine management software reduce fuel consumption by up to 15% compared to previous-generation heavy trucks — significantly lowering the total cost of ownership for fleet operators.

Deep-Dive: Where Big Trucks Power Industrial & Steel Coil Transport

The operational environments for oversized industrial machinery and steel coil transportation span an extraordinary range of industries, geographies, and logistical complexities. Understanding these application scenarios is essential to selecting the right heavy truck configuration.

01

🏭 Steel Mill & Coil Service Center Logistics

Steel coils produced at integrated steel mills must be transported to coil service centers, automotive stamping plants, and construction material distributors. This requires flatbed tractor-trailer combinations with coil cradle bodies, capable of handling individual coil weights of 10–28 tonnes. High-frequency, short-to-medium haul cycles demand trucks with exceptional durability and low maintenance intervals to sustain continuous operational throughput.

02

⚡ Power Generation Equipment Transport

Gas turbines, steam generators, and large transformers used in power plant construction are among the most challenging oversized cargo categories. Individual components can weigh hundreds of tonnes and measure over 10 meters in length. Specialized multi-axle lowboy trailers paired with high-output prime movers navigate complex permit routes, requiring meticulous route surveys and precision driver expertise.

03

⛏️ Mining & Quarrying Equipment Relocation

Mining operations require periodic relocation of excavators, haul trucks, crushers, and processing equipment between sites. The combination of extreme weights, off-road access requirements, and remote locations demands heavy trucks with exceptional off-road capability, high ground clearance, and robust drivetrain protection systems capable of operating in harsh environmental conditions.

04

🏗️ Construction & Infrastructure Project Support

Large-scale infrastructure projects — bridges, tunnels, airports, and industrial parks — require continuous delivery of prefabricated steel structures, precast concrete elements, and heavy construction machinery. Just-in-time delivery schedules and complex urban routing demand intelligent fleet management systems integrated with real-time traffic and permit management platforms.

05

🚢 Port & Intermodal Terminal Operations

Steel coils arriving by sea or rail require efficient drayage from port terminals to inland processing facilities. Port environments present unique challenges including congested access routes, strict emissions zones, and 24/7 operational demands. Modern heavy trucks equipped with automated transmission, low-emission engines, and advanced driver assistance systems (ADAS) are increasingly preferred by port logistics operators.

06

🌐 Cross-Border & Corridor Heavy Haulage

International heavy haulage along major trade corridors — including Belt and Road Initiative routes across Central Asia, the Trans-African Highway network, and Southeast Asian industrial corridors — requires trucks engineered for extreme reliability across varied road surfaces, climatic extremes, and diverse fuel quality conditions. The Future of Big Trucks in Industrial & Steel Coil Transportation

The heavy haulage sector is undergoing a profound technological and commercial transformation, driven by digitalization, sustainability mandates, and evolving supply chain architectures. Understanding these trends is critical for fleet operators and industrial logistics planners.

TREND 01 · ELECTRIFICATION
Electric & Hydrogen-Powered Heavy Trucks Enter Industrial Logistics
While battery-electric trucks currently face payload and range limitations for the heaviest industrial haulage applications, rapid advances in battery energy density and hydrogen fuel cell technology are accelerating the transition. Short-haul steel coil distribution within industrial parks and port terminals is already being served by electric prime movers in pilot deployments across Europe and China, with broader commercial rollout expected by 2027–2030.
TREND 02 · AUTONOMOUS DRIVING
Level 2–4 Autonomous Heavy Trucks Reshape Industrial Supply Chains
Advanced driver assistance systems (ADAS) incorporating lane-keeping, adaptive cruise control, automatic emergency braking, and platooning capabilities are now standard on premium heavy trucks. Semi-autonomous platooning — where a lead truck guides a convoy of following vehicles — can reduce fuel consumption by 10–15% on highway routes, directly benefiting high-volume steel coil trunk line logistics operations.
TREND 03 · DIGITAL INTEGRATION
IoT, Big Data & AI-Driven Fleet Management Platforms
The integration of IoT sensors, big data analytics, and AI-powered predictive maintenance platforms is transforming fleet management for industrial haulage operators. Real-time monitoring of engine health, tire pressure, load distribution, and driver behavior enables proactive maintenance scheduling, reduces unplanned breakdowns by up to 40%, and optimizes total cost of ownership across large fleets transporting oversized industrial cargo.
TREND 04 · SUSTAINABILITY
Stricter Emissions Standards Drive Next-Generation Engine Development
Increasingly stringent emissions regulations — Euro VI, China VI, and equivalent standards globally — are compelling heavy truck manufacturers to invest heavily in advanced combustion technology, exhaust aftertreatment systems, and alternative fuel compatibility. For steel coil and industrial machinery transport operators, compliance with these standards is now a prerequisite for accessing urban delivery zones and winning major industrial contracts.
TREND 05 · MODULAR DESIGN
Modular Truck-Trailer Systems Maximize Operational Flexibility
The growing diversity of oversized industrial cargo — from steel coils to wind turbine components to mining equipment — is driving demand for modular heavy truck and trailer systems. Interchangeable trailer configurations, adjustable axle spacings, and universal fifth-wheel coupling systems allow fleet operators to serve multiple industrial sectors with a single prime mover platform, maximizing asset utilization and return on investment.

Total Cost of Ownership: The Business Case for Purpose-Built Heavy Trucks

For industrial logistics operators and fleet managers, the decision to invest in purpose-built heavy trucks for oversized machinery and steel coil transport is fundamentally a financial and operational risk management decision. The total cost of ownership (TCO) framework encompasses acquisition cost, fuel expenditure, maintenance and repair, tire lifecycle, driver productivity, and cargo loss prevention.

💰

Reduced Fuel Costs

Aerodynamic optimization, intelligent transmission management, and engine downsizing with turbocharging deliver measurable fuel savings of 8–15% versus previous-generation trucks, translating to significant annual cost reductions for high-mileage industrial fleets.

🔧

Extended Service Intervals

Advanced lubrication systems, wear-resistant components, and predictive maintenance technology extend service intervals and reduce unplanned workshop visits — minimizing revenue-generating downtime for critical industrial supply chain operations.

📦

Cargo Protection & Loss Prevention

Specialized load securing systems and suspension technology minimize cargo damage during transit. For high-value steel coils and precision industrial machinery, even a single damage incident can exceed the annual maintenance cost of an entire truck — making cargo protection a primary commercial consideration.

📈

Higher Payload Efficiency

Optimized chassis weight and axle configuration maximize legal payload capacity, allowing operators to carry more cargo per trip. For steel coil distributors and industrial equipment movers, maximizing payload per journey directly improves revenue per vehicle per day.

🛡️

Regulatory Compliance

Purpose-built heavy trucks engineered to meet international axle load limits, emissions standards, and safety regulations eliminate costly fines, permit delays, and operational restrictions — protecting business continuity and customer relationships.

🔄

Residual Value Retention

Premium heavy trucks from established manufacturers maintain stronger residual values in secondary markets, reducing the net cost of fleet renewal cycles and providing greater financial flexibility for fleet expansion or diversification strategies.
